The European Federation of Journalists Demanded the Immediate Release of Yulia Slutskaya and Her Colleagues

Repression of the independent press must end.

The European Federation of Journalists (EFJ) demanded an immediate end to repressions against journalists and the release of the Press Club representatives detained the day before. The corresponding statement is posted on the organization's website, tut.by writes.

As the organization notes, after the introduction of new sanctions by the EU, Belarusian Foreign Minister Uladzimir Makei announced retaliatory measures against Belarusian organizations that operate with the support of foreign embassies: "Among the first victims of this new wave of repression is Yulia Slutskaya, founder of the Press Club Belarus, Member of the Board of BAJ."

Searches also took place at several employees of the press club, including Ala Sharko, Siarhei Alsheuski, Siarhei Yakupau.

"This repression must end immediately. We demand the release of Yulia and all her colleagues. We call on the European Union, the Council of Europe, and the OSCE to respond decisively to this new wave of repression," said EFJ President Mogens Blicher Bjerregard.

Let us remind you that on December 22, security officials came to the Belarusian Press Club. After that, at least six people who are related to the organization stopped contacting.
